The Ultimate Guide To what is md5 technology
The Ultimate Guide To what is md5 technology
Blog Article
What this means is it could be easily implemented in systems with constrained means. So, no matter whether It is a powerful server or your very own personal computer, MD5 can comfortably look for a home there.
One method to increase the security of MD5 is by utilizing a way called 'salting'. This is often like incorporating an extra magic formula component to your favorite recipe.
The Luhn algorithm, also known as the modulus 10 or mod ten algorithm, is a simple checksum method utilized to validate many different identification quantities, such as bank card quantities, IMEI numbers, Canadian Social Insurance policies Numbers.
Irrespective of its velocity and simplicity, the safety flaws in MD5 have brought about its gradual deprecation, with more secure options like SHA-256 being proposed for apps in which information integrity and authenticity are crucial.
Enable us improve. Share your solutions to boost the report. Contribute your knowledge and produce a variance within the GeeksforGeeks portal.
Some different types of hackers can create inputs to supply similar hash values. When two competing messages provide the exact hash code, this is called a collision attack, although MD5 hash collisions also can come about unintentionally.
In case the hashes match, it indicates the evidence is unaltered and can be utilized in courtroom.Nonetheless, it is necessary to note that MD5 is currently deemed weak and never secure for cryptographic functions because of its vulnerability to hash collision attacks. Safer possibilities, like SHA-two or SHA-three, are advisable for cryptographic apps.
So how does an MD5 purpose work? Fundamentally, you feed this Software information—whether or not a document, a video clip, a piece of code, anything—and in return, MD5 will crank out a novel and glued-sized hash code. read more If even just one character is altered in that initial established of data, it might make a very various hash.
Stick to MD5 can be a cryptographic hash operate algorithm that normally takes the concept as input of any length and modifications it into a fixed-length information of sixteen bytes. MD5 algorithm means the Concept-Digest algorithm. MD5 was produced in 1991 by Ronald Rivest as an improvement of MD4, with advanced stability applications.
A person-way compression features can’t deal with variable inputs, so MD5 receives all around this by padding out its info, to make sure that it is often processed in 512-bit blocks of knowledge.
Initial off, MD5 is rapidly and economical. It's such as the hare from the race against the tortoise—it gets The task performed immediately. This speed is actually a important aspect if you're processing large amounts of knowledge.
When you ponder the probability of a hashing attack on 1 of one's methods, it's important to notice that Despite having MD5, the chances are greatly within your favor. A hash attack can only occur when two different inputs deliver the exact same hash output.
You may Typically see MD5 hashes created in hexadecimal (sixteen), and that is an alternate numeral method. In daily life, we make use of the decimal program which counts from zero to nine right before heading back to the zero yet again, this time using a 1 before it to indicate that this is the next instalment one particular via 9 (10-19).
In 1996, collisions had been present in the compression operate of MD5, and Hans Dobbertin wrote from the RSA Laboratories technological e-newsletter, "The presented attack doesn't but threaten functional apps of MD5, but it surely will come alternatively shut .